Summary

In this episode of The PDB Situation Report: We'll start off today's program by looking at the life and death of the man known as "The Butcher of Tehran"--late Iranian President Ebrahim Raisi, who met his fate in the mountains of northern Iran this week. We'll be joined by Behnam Ben Taleblu of the Foundation for the Defense of Democracies. He'll give us some insight into what Raisi's death means for the regime. A little later, we'll turn to the Far East, where China has launched aggressive military drills surrounding its neighbor Taiwan. Author Gordon Chang shares his thoughts on the escalating tensions there. Plus, we take a look at a silent crisis at America's southern border as the horrible realities on the ground take their toll on America's border patrol agents.
